Modi and Xi meet for a one-on-one session



TAMIL NADU: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Chinese President Xi Jinping are meeting for a one-on-one session at Mahabalipuram, in the Indian state of Tamil Nadu.

After the meeting, Chinese President Xi will leave for Nepal on a two-day state visit.

The two leaders spent about five hours of ‘quality time and discussion’ on Friday in Tamil Nadu. (Agencies)
